Maker Projects – Community STEM Engagement grants 2024
Australian Government · Australia
Grants of $20,000 to $100,000 were available to support maker projects that foster creativity, inquiry-based learning and STEM skill development in students and youth under 18 through hands-on activities in design, engineering and programming. The program particularly focused on under-represented groups and improving access in regional, rural, remote and disadvantaged communities.

Who is eligible for the Maker Projects – Community STEM Engagement grants 2024?
- Applicants are organisations that deliver maker projects to students and youth under 18 years
- Projects must foster creativity, inquiry-based learning and STEM skill development through hands-on learning
- Activities are focused on design, engineering and programming
- Particular focus is on under-represented groups including young women and girls
- Particular focus includes First Nations peoples
- Particular focus includes youth living in regional, rural and remote locations
- Particular focus includes culturally and linguistically diverse communities
- Particular focus includes people with disability
- Particular focus includes people from educationally disadvantaged backgrounds
